G-DRAGON is taking his love for McDonald’s from fan to frontman, starring in a new campaign film for the fast-food giant’s Asia-wide collaboration with the K-pop star.

The short film plays up the singer’s apparent affinity for the brand, opening with G-DRAGON leaning against an iconic McDonald’s bench as he poses for photos before showing off his McDonald’s merchandise and collectibles.

He then bites into McNuggets before heading to a McDonald’s drive-through, much to the surprise of the employees who appear shocked to see the star pull up himself.

The film goes on to reveal the latest menu item created for the collaboration, before G-DRAGON takes a bite of the burger and McNuggets to close out the spot.

The collaboration, which begins across 13 Asian markets from 17 September, was developed by McDonald’s Korea and centres on a new Gochujang butter sauce. Participating markets will feature the sauce in different menu offerings.

The partnership also extends beyond the menu, with G-DRAGON’s label PEACEMINUSONE set to release limited-edition merchandise with McDonald’s later this month. Further details on the collection are expected to be revealed closer to its release.

In a separate video shared by McDonald’s Philippines, G-DRAGON addressed fans across Asia, saying he was happy to become a model for a brand he has always loved and encouraged fans to show the collaboration plenty of love and “enjoy every bite”.

The G-DRAGON collaboration is not McDonald’s first foray into K-pop fandom. In 2021, the brand partnered with BTS for its first celebrity signature order programme outside the US, taking the BTS Meal across nearly 50 marketsincluding Singapore, Malaysia, Indonesia, the Philippines and South Korea. At the time, McDonald’s Asia said the collaboration benefited from strong organic fan interest, with some markets recording sales well above projections.

More recently, McDonald’s has continued to blend K-pop, food and collectability. In 2025, McDonald’s Singapore and Malaysia brought TinyTAN, the animated characters inspired by BTS, into Happy Meals, while McDonald’s Hong Kong partnered with BABYMONSTER on a McCrispy campaign and limited-edition collectibles.
